BULLETIN 91-01 24 HOUR REPORT
On March 7, 2000 at 1410 hours, it was discovered that a plastic 55 gallon laundry drum (containing used rubber totes) was left unattended in the X-705 Decontamination Building High Bay Area with the lid ajar. Following correction, the condition was identified again at 1508 hours. This violates requirement #5 of NCSA-0705_076.A00 which requires modification or covering of containers to prevent geometrically unfavorable accumulation of uranium bearing solution. This constitutes the loss of Control A (Volume) of the double contingency principle. Control B (primary integrity or the overhead piping) was maintained throughout the event. Each of the two non-compliances identified was corrected within thirty minutes of discovery under the direction of plant Nuclear Criticality Safety personnel. Following discovery of the repeat occurrence, a facility stand down was initiated in X-705 to conduct crew briefings and determine appropriate follow-up.
The licensee notified the NRC resident inspector.

- TEN OFFSITE EMERGENCY SIRENS INOPERABLE FOR 19 MINUTES -
At 1504 on 03/07/00, the licensee notified Brunswick County Officials that ten offsite emergency sirens for Brunswick County were inoperable from 1444 to 1503 on 03/07/00. Alternate offsite notification mechanisms were available during this 19 minute period.
The licensee notified the NRC Resident Inspector.

- NEWS RELEASE REGARDING THE RETRIEVAL OF BOXES OF RADIOACTIVE WASTE -
The following news release was issued by the licensee to the general public at 1422 PST on 03/07/00 regarding the retrieval of boxes of radioactive waste that also may contain a hazardous substance:
"Energy Northwest retrieves low-level radioactive waste shipment - RICHLAND, WA --
Acting on its own initiative, Energy Northwest has retrieved four boxes of low-level radioactive waste from US Ecology Inc. because the boxes possibly also contain what is classified as a hazardous substance. The combination of radioactive and hazardous wastes is considered mixed waste. US Ecology operates the commercial low-level radioactive waste disposal site at Hanford. US Ecology is not licensed to accept mixed waste. Energy Northwest discovered this potential problem internally and notified US Ecology, the state departments of Health and Ecology, the Nuclear Regulatory Commission and other interested parties. Energy Northwest owns the Northwest's only commercial nuclear power plant, which produces enough electricity to serve a city the size of Seattle with power at a competitive price. The plant is located about 10 miles north of Richland. During the plant's last refueling outage, which ended in October, Energy Northwest used a specialized process to clean and coat the interior of certain steam lines that had become somewhat corroded during 15 years of operation. The pipe was cleaned with blasting grit that became slightly radioactive. The grit and the corrosion deposits removed from the pipe are considered to be low-level waste. Immediately after cleaning, a metal coating was sprayed onto the inside of the piping. The spray was created by melting a nickel-chromium wire in an electrical arc, creating fine particles that coated the walls of the piping. Some of these fine particles possibly mixed with some of the used grit. The nickel-chromium wire is made of materials very much like those used to make kitchen cookware. However, under certain conditions nickel-chromium could be considered to be hazardous waste. When the pipe cleaning-coating operation was under way, it wasn't clear to Energy Northwest officials that the final waste could be classified as mixed waste. In October, waste from the pipe operation was gathered and placed in four metal boxes, each four feet by four feet by six feet. In December, the boxes were taken to the US Ecology disposal site on the Hanford Nuclear Reservation. The US Ecology site is licensed for low-level radioactive waste, such as that from medical clinics. In January, an Energy Northwest employee questioned whether the mixture of arc-spray residue and grit might possibly be classified as mixed waste, rather than low-level waste. Energy Northwest then told US Ecology it would retrieve the boxes. The boxes had not yet been buried. Energy Northwest retrieved the boxes in late February. A plan to sample and analyze waste is being prepared. The material will be tested to determine if the waste should be classified as mixed waste. If not, the boxes will be returned to US Ecology. If the waste is classified as mixed waste, Energy Northwest will explore other storage and disposal options."
The licensee notified Washington State Officials and plan to notify the NRC Resident Inspector.

- C-333A AUTOCLAVE WATER INVENTORY CONTROL SYSTEM PRIMARY CONDENSATE ALARM RECD -
At 0232 CST on 03/07/00, the Plant Shift Superintendent (PSS) was notified that a primary condensate alarm was received on the C-333A Position 2 South autoclave Water Inventory Control (WIC) System. The WIC System is required to be operable while heating in Mode 5 according to TSR 2.2.4.2. The autoclave was checked according to the alarm response procedure, removed from service, and the WIC System was declared inoperable by the PSS.
Troubleshooting was Initiated and is continuing in order to determine the reason for the alarm.
The safety system actuation is reportable to the NRC as required by Safety Analysis Report, Section 6.9, Table 1, Criterion J.2, Safety System Actuation due to a valid signal as a 24-hour event notification.
The NRC resident Inspector has been notified of this event.
PGDP Problem Report No, ATR-00-1340; PGDP Event Report No, PAD-2000-020.

BULLETIN 91-01 24 HOUR REPORT
At 1038 hours on 3/7/00, it was discovered that a 5 gallon bucket containing used, potentially contaminated oil was spaced less than 2 feet from another like container. The two containers were 23 inches apart rather than the minimum 24 inches required by NCSA-PLANTO45.AO1 Requirement #5. This spacing violation constitutes the loss of one control of the double contingency principle. The spacing violation was corrected at 1055 hours. A walk-down of the affected area verified that no other spacing issues exist.
The licensee notified the NRC resident inspector.

24-HOUR CONDITION OF LICENSE REPORT INVOLVING TECH SPEC REQUIREMENTS
"On February 9, 2000, it was discovered that the Flux Multiplication Alarm (which is used to mitigate boron dilution accidents) was not functional. It was not recognized at that time that this caused the associated extended range neutron detector to be inoperable. If an extended range detector is inoperable in Modes 3, 4, and 5 the Technical Specifications requires that operations be suspended involving positive reactivity changes.
"On March 1, 2000 at 0017 hours Unit 1 entered Mode 3 as part of a shutdown to support refueling activities.
Immediately following Mode 3 entry testing was performed which involves raising control rods to perform drop
testing. Raising control rods constitutes positive reactivity which is contrary to requirements of the Technical
Specifications.
"This notification is being made pursuant to Operating License NPF-76 Condition 2.G for operation or condition prohibited by Technical Specifications."
The licensee will inform the NRC resident inspector.
* * * UPDATE AT 1417 ON 03/27/00 BY KEN TAPLETT TO JOLLIFFE * * *
Further licensee review determined that the extended range neutron detector in question had been operable during the positive reactivity change activity. During the time of the original notification, the Flux Multiplication Alarm was thought to be non-functional. A non-functional Flux Multiplication Alarm causes the associated extended range neutron detector to be inoperable. It was determined that the Flux Multiplication Alarm was actually functional at the completion of surveillance testing conducted on February 9, 2000. The surveillance procedure requires an alarm reset prior to exiting the surveillance test which arms the Flux Multiplication Alarm circuit thus making it functional. Although this step was performed on February 9, 2000, the performers did not recognize at the time that this corrected the perceived loss of alarm function.
Prior to the February 9, 2000 surveillance test, the last satisfactory performance of the Flux Multiplication Alarm surveillance was conducted on November 16, 1999 with a grace period to March 10, 2000. Unit 1 entered Mode 6 (where the requirement was no longer applicable) on March 3, 2000 and has remained in that mode for a refueling and steam generator replacement outage. A satisfactory surveillance test was conducted on March 16, 2000.
The licensee plans to revise the test procedure to preclude recurrence of this event.
Based upon the above justification, the licensee desires to retract this event.
The licensee notified the NRC Resident Inspector.
The NRC Operations Officer notified the R4DO Kriss Kennedy.
